A psychiatric examination could be required when feelings begin to impact daily life, or cause stress in work and family relationships. A mental health professional like psychiatrist, psychologist or psychotherapist, will examine to see if a person is suffering from a mental health assesment disorder, or whether their symptoms are caused by other conditions.

During a psychiatric evaluation the doctor will ask questions about your thoughts, feelings and behaviors. They will also want to know about your family history, the medications you are taking and any other psychiatric treatments that you have tried in the past. If you can't explain your symptoms, your doctor will try to understand the causes of them through discussions with others who know you well. This could include your partner or parents, or your friends. You must be as sincere as you can to ensure that your doctor is able to provide the best care possible.

In addition to this meeting in person, your psychiatrist may also request lab tests such as a blood test or brain scan to help them determine the root of your symptoms. There are instances that a physical problem such as thyroid issues can be a sign of mental health issues and cause them to become worse, so these tests will be necessary to rule out physical causes. They may also ask about your alcohol or drug use.

Once your psychiatric examination is completed your psychiatrist will design an individual treatment plan that may include medication, psychotherapy or both. They will also keep track of your progress and make any necessary adjustments. You may require additional psychiatric evaluations in the future.

Psychological Evaluation

Psychological evaluations are used to determine the next steps an individual should take to recover from mental health issues. They can also give more insight into an individual's strengths and weaknesses. They can aid individuals in understanding the triggers that cause their symptoms and help them identify efficient coping strategies. Families and friends can also benefit from psychological assessments, as they will be able to better comprehend the person's condition.

Psychiatric examinations are typically conducted by a psychiatrist, though other mental health professionals may also be involved. They will take a complete medical history and conduct tests to determine if there are any physical causes for the individual's symptoms. They will ask questions about the person's thoughts, feelings and behaviors and focus on how they affect their day-to-day life. If appropriate, they might discuss the person's family and social background.

A psychiatric evaluation is usually the first step in receiving treatment for mental disorders. Patients who experience negative emotions such as depression or anxiety should see a doctor as soon as possible to stop the problem from worsening. These emotions are normal but they shouldn't last more than a few weeks or hinder your daily activities. The psychiatric examinations are typically covered by insurance companies, therefore it is worthwhile to check with your insurance provider to determine the coverage you're entitled to.

The process of evaluation will involve psychological testing as well as a clinical interview. A psychiatrist or psychologist will use the results of the test to make an assessment and suggest the best treatment options for an individual. The tests for psychological health are likely to be standardised, which means they are designed to measure specific aspects of a person's mental functioning. These tests are similar to those that students take to gauge how they're doing in the classroom or on college preparation tests like the SAT and ACT.

The clinical interview can aid the therapist in getting an understanding of the person's mood and behavior. They will inquire about the person's day-to-day life, their social and family life, and how the symptoms affect their work and relationships. They will also conduct a social observation, which entails watching the person in their everyday life and observing how they interact with others.
